Meet Lucy - a teenager who's about to get an "A" in fighting vampiresLucy Hellenberg is not your typical Pacific Cedar High student. Because in between hanging out with her friends, hating her hair and her math teacher, and trying to decide whether she should dump her on-again off-again boyfriend, she has to deal with a father who refuses to go outside and a house that bears way too much resemblance to the set of The Munsters.And that's not all. Lucy has just discovered that she's a descendent of the lovely Lucy in Bram Stoker's Dracula-and that vampires really do exist (right here at Pacific Cedar High!). Now, she has to accessorize her homecoming dress with a necklace of garlic and learn how to drive while driving away vampires-without becoming their next victim.
Is High School Bites appropriate for my child?
Suitable for most readers 13 and up.
This lighthearted vampire story features mild supernatural peril and teen relationship drama but focuses primarily on humor and coming-of-age themes. No graphic content or strong language.
What to know going in
This book has mild violence, no sexual content, and mild language.
